Fort Worth Opera Association Inc. (EIN: 75-0945915) has filed an IRS Form 990 since at least fiscal year 2016. In its fiscal year 2016 IRS Form 990 filing, Fort Worth Opera Association Inc., a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 2 out of 179 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$163,014. The highest compensated employee at Fort Worth Opera Association Inc. is Darren Woods with fiscal year 2016 compensation of $234,159.

Mission Statement

The mission of Fort Worth Opera is to enrich people's lives with performances and programs that educate, entertain, inspire, and expand the horizons of current and future audiences.
